What is this device?

This is the USB identifier for a Thymio-II manufactured by Swiss Federal Insitute of Technology. The vendor ID 0617 is registered to Swiss Federal Insitute of Technology with the USB Implementers Forum, and 000a is the product ID that Swiss Federal Insitute of Technology assigned to this particular model. When you run lsusb on Linux, this device appears as 0617:000a Swiss Federal Insitute of Technology Thymio-II.

How to identify it on your system

Linux

$ lsusb
Bus 001 Device 004: ID 0617:000a Swiss Federal Insitute of Technology Thymio-II

You can filter directly with lsusb -d 0617:000a, or get the full descriptor dump with lsusb -v -d 0617:000a. Kernel messages from dmesg show the same pair as idVendor=0617, idProduct=000a.

Windows

In Device Manager, open the device, go to Details → Hardware Ids. This device reports:

USB\VID_0617&PID_000A
USB\VID_0617&PID_000A&REV_0100

From PowerShell: Get-PnpDevice | Where-Object InstanceId -match "VID_0617&PID_000A"

macOS

$ system_profiler SPUSBDataType
    Thymio-II:
      Product ID: 0x000a
      Vendor ID: 0x0617  (Swiss Federal Insitute of Technology)
